The PM10CSJ060 power module has a standard TO-247 pin configuration with detailed pinout information available in the product datasheet.
The PM10CSJ060 utilizes silicon carbide technology to enable high-frequency switching and lower conduction losses. The integrated gate driver ensures precise control of the switching process, resulting in improved overall system efficiency.
The PM10CSJ060 is suitable for various applications including: - Solar inverters - Electric vehicle charging systems - Industrial motor drives - Uninterruptible power supplies (UPS) - Renewable energy systems
In conclusion, the PM10CSJ060 is a high-performance silicon carbide power module designed for efficient power conversion and control in various industrial and renewable energy applications.
